#bb0f69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b0f69 is composed of 73.3% red, 5.9%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92% magenta, 43.9%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 328.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 39.6%. #bb0f69 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1ed2 with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#bb0f69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050003 is the darkest color, while #fef2f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b0f69

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666465 is the less saturated color, while #c30769 is the most saturated one.
